About Anil Kumar

Anil Kumar is a scholar working on Organic Chemistry, Materials Chemistry, Molecular Biology, Catalysis and Electrical and Electronic Engineering, having authored 386 papers that have together received 7.6k indexed citations. Recurring topics across this work include Catalytic C–H Functionalization Methods (72 papers), Chemical Synthesis and Reactions (51 papers), Multicomponent Synthesis of Heterocycles (37 papers), Sulfur-Based Synthesis Techniques (37 papers), Synthesis and Biological Evaluation (33 papers), Ionic liquids properties and applications (32 papers), Oxidative Organic Chemistry Reactions (29 papers) and Catalytic Cross-Coupling Reactions (23 papers). The work is most often cited by research in Organic Chemistry (4.6k citations), Filtration and Separation (308 citations), Catalysis (999 citations), Fluid Flow and Transfer Processes (285 citations) and Toxicology (106 citations). Anil Kumar has collaborated with scholars based in India, United States and Canada. Frequent co-authors include S. M. S. Chauhan, Kasiviswanadharaju Pericherla, Nidhi Jain, Keykavous Parang, Sushma Chauhan, Ganesh M. Shelke, Pinku Kaswan, Nitesh Kumar Nandwana, Bharti Khungar and Dalip Kumar. Their work appears in journals such as The Journal of Organic Chemistry, Organic & Biomolecular Chemistry, RSC Advances, Synlett and Bioorganic & Medicinal Chemistry Letters.
